The PETERSON CONTRACTORS, INC. 401(k) on its latest Form 5500
PETERSON CONTRACTORS, INC. (EIN 42-0921654) reports PETERSON CONTRACTORS, INC. PROFIT SHARING P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$76.4M in plan assets across 699 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the PETERSON CONTRACTORS, INC. 401(k)?
The plan’s recordkeeper — the firm that runs the website and statements where you check your balance, change contributions, and manage your account — is Vanguard, based on the plan’s Schedule C service-provider disclosure. That’s the login you use for your PETERSON CONTRACTORS, INC. 401(k).
